Me and my husband stayed in Takimikan for one night during our honeymoon to Japan and it was amazing! Since the ryokan is located at the back of Ginzan Onsen, it was very convenient to use the provided shuttle bus service from the nearest train station. Otherwise it's a bit of a walk from the regular bus stop. We explored the mountain area and park before it got dark (which was a good decision since it might be slippery to go up there at night), it had such beautiful scenery. Walking the town both during daylight and evening, the atmosphere was magical during both times. The ryokans lining the main street seemed a bit cramped, so we were glad to have chosen Takimikan. Our room was on the second floor of the main building, spacious, with a wonderful view of the mountains, woods and the waterfall downhill. The food was delicious, both the luxurious dinner and invigorating breakfast, plus we had the best umeshu of our 4-week trip at Takimikan...it was impossible to drink just one glass. The service was impeccable, staff was friendly and helpful. I can speak Japanese so it was easy for me to communicate, but I could see that the staff were attentive also to English-speaking guests via the use of a translation app. The outdoor onsen was also nice, listening to the sound of the waterfall after a tiring day was relaxing. If we ever get a chance to go back to Ginzan Onsen, I would definitely like to stay here again.
